CO:SAMPLE_TYPE Spleen #TREATMENT TR:TREATMENT_SUMMARY Approximately 30% of the cecum was ligated and punctured twice with a 23 Gauge TR:TREATMENT_SUMMARY (G) needle. A small amount of faeces was extruded and the cecum was placed back TR:TREATMENT_SUMMARY into the abdominal cavity. All animals received 40 mL/kg saline s.c. directly TR:TREATMENT_SUMMARY after the procedure and once 25mg/kg s.c. Imipenem/Cilastatin after 6 hours. TR:TREATMENT_SUMMARY This model is associated with a 14-day mortality of 30%, closely mimicking the TR:TREATMENT_SUMMARY clinical situation. Animals were orally gavaged with 500mg/kg 12C-Serin (Sigma) TR:TREATMENT_SUMMARY or 13C-Serin (CLM-1574-H-0.25 Serine-L (13C3 99%13C), Euroisotope, Germany) in TR:TREATMENT_SUMMARY 10mL/kg drinking water or drinking water only (vehicle) 6 and 18 hours after TR:TREATMENT_SUMMARY CLP98,99. After 24 hours, the animals are then perfused with ice cold PBS and TR:TREATMENT_SUMMARY organs were harvested, snap frozen and stored at -80° until further analysis. TR:TREATMENT_SUMMARY Sham animals underwent exactly to the same procedures except for the CLP. #SAMPLEPREP SP:SAMPLEPREP_SUMMARY To prepare samples for semi-polar metabolites extraction, the different tissue SP:SAMPLEPREP_SUMMARY samples were weighted and transferred to Eppendorf tubes. Ceramic beads and SP:SAMPLEPREP_SUMMARY precooled methanol/water (1:2) were added. All tubes were placed in a pre-cooled SP:SAMPLEPREP_SUMMARY (-20°C) bead beater and homogenized (4 x 30 sec., 30 Hz) followed by SP:SAMPLEPREP_SUMMARY ultrasonication (5 min). After centrifugation (18000 RCF, 5 min, 4°C), the SP:SAMPLEPREP_SUMMARY supernatant was collected. The sample pellet was reextracted as described above. SP:SAMPLEPREP_SUMMARY The two extract supernatants were pooled and passed through a phosphor removal SP:SAMPLEPREP_SUMMARY cartridge (Phree filter plates). A precise aliquot of the extract was evaporated SP:SAMPLEPREP_SUMMARY to dryness under a gentle stream of nitrogen, before reconstitution with 10% SP:SAMPLEPREP_SUMMARY Eluent B in Eluent A. All Samples were diluted 5 times in mobile phase eluent A SP:SAMPLEPREP_SUMMARY and stable isotope labelled standards were added before analysis. Mouse serum SP:SAMPLEPREP_SUMMARY (50 μl) was diluted with a mixture of acetonitrile and methanol (200 μl 1:1 SP:SAMPLEPREP_SUMMARY v/v). The extract was then passed through a phosphor removal cartridge (Phree, SP:SAMPLEPREP_SUMMARY Phenomenex). An aliquot (100 μl) was transferred into a high recovery HPLC vial SP:SAMPLEPREP_SUMMARY and the solvent was removed under a gentle flow of nitrogen. Extracts were SP:SAMPLEPREP_SUMMARY reconstituted in a mobile phase mixture (100 μl, 10%B in 90%A). MS:MS_COMMENTS The analysis was carried out using a Vanquish LC (Thermo Scientific) coupled to MS:MS_COMMENTS a Orbitrap Exploris 240 MS (Thermo Scientific). The UHPLC was performed using an MS:MS_COMMENTS adapted version of the protocol described by Doneanu et al . An electrospray MS:MS_COMMENTS ionization interface was used as ionization source. Analysis was performed in MS:MS_COMMENTS positive and negative ionization mode under polarity switching. Metabolomics MS:MS_COMMENTS processing was performed untargeted using Compound Discoverer 3.3 (Thermo MS:MS_COMMENTS Scientific) and Skyline 22.2 (MacCoss Lab Software) for peak picking and feature MS:MS_COMMENTS grouping, followed by an in-house annotation and curation pipeline written in MS:MS_COMMENTS MatLab (2022b, MathWorks). Identification of compounds were performed at four MS:MS_COMMENTS levels; Level 1: identification by retention times (compared against in-house MS:MS_COMMENTS authentic standards), accurate mass (with an accepted deviation of 3ppm), and MS:MS_COMMENTS MS/MS spectra, Level 2a: identification by retention times (compared against MS:MS_COMMENTS in-house authentic standards), accurate mass (with an accepted deviation of MS:MS_COMMENTS 3ppm). Level 2b: identification by accurate mass (with an accepted deviation of MS:MS_COMMENTS 3ppm), and MS/MS spectra, Level 3: identification by accurate mass alone (with MS:MS_COMMENTS an accepted deviation of 3ppm). The data have been normalized to the QC samples MS:MS_COMMENTS to remove systematic drift over the analysis sequence. The normalization is MS:MS_COMMENTS performed using linear regression for the QC’s within each analytical batch MS:MS_COMMENTS with signal = a*injection number – b. Each value is then normalized with: MS:MS_COMMENTS normSignal = average(all QC samples)*(signal – injection number*a)/b. This is MS:MS_COMMENTS done independently for each compound.
